I purchased a vehicle from JD Byrider/CNAC Finance/Harold Zeigler Auto Group on July 11, 2002. I was fully aware of the fact I was purchasing a used vehicle at the legal limit loan interest rate of 24.90% APR, but heck..I needed a car. I bought a 1994 Pontiac Grand Prix, thought it was a decent vehicle and sales personell guaranteed me the car was without problem in any area. I drove the car approximately 2 miles from the dealership on that same day in July of 2002 and the front driver's side window fell down, unable to be put back in place using electric switch.

I pulled out my cell phone immediately, enraged, spoke with Service Manager who assured me that the problem would be resolved immediately! I felt better, but to my suprise this car window had been back in for repairs on 8 seperate occasions for the same related problem since then.

In Feb of 2003 I lost my job and had to become delinquent in payments on the loan. Personnell in Finance (CNAC) were very understanding, stating they just wanted communication about my situation. I did what i could for payment on the loan. I became employed with the same JD Byrider/CNAC/Harold Zeigler Auto Group on August 2, 2003 as a part time clerk in the finance department. I was treated like s**t! I still made payment arrangements to catch up with the delinquency. I was the only person of ethnic backround on-site and was never allowed to forget that. I had heard account reps speak to people with so much disrespect! Example: I read in notes on a coversation with a customer and a Representative: "Have a good trip back to Africa... I hear they have mammoth sized bugs!"

I also was attempting to get the same d**n window fixed, which was now taped up with yellow duct tape, and had been courtesy of service personnell for about 2 months. I was blowed of an blowed off, given the "Well, you know, you did buy a used car", speech several times by the service manager. I went to his supervisor asking that something be done, It worked for a minute, I got a new door for the car, hoping that would handle the window problem. The only thing is, the motor that operates the window was never hooked back up and now the window won't come down at all! After that happened my husband confronted the service manager, who was very rude, telling him it's not his fault and that the door costed him $500 to replace! Big deal.. the d**n window was broken when I bought the car!... He knew that. My husband became extremely angry and left the building.

I went to my supervisor 45 minutes before my shift was to end and explained what happened, she said.. well it's not going to get fixed until you catch up with your payments anyway.. I told her then that I needed to leave early to try to calm hubby down. She said to me: "You have a job to do.. you need to sit back down!"... Now my mother and father are dead and NO ONE...REPEAT... NO ONE.. will be allowed to speak to me in that manner, especially for a 20 per week, 7.50 per hour job... so i told her to kiss my a*s.. I quit!

I advise anyone in the Kalamazoo/Battle Creek, MI or Lansing, MI area.. Do not purchase a vehicle from them... I know inside and out how they work!
